Santa's crackme intro

We have to reverse the binary. Decompiled code: Santa's crackme decompiled

The program basically XOR our input with number 3 and then compare the result with 'flag_matrix' which is: Santa's crackme string

The XOR has the commutative property:

input ^ 3 = flag_matrix

flag_matrix ^ 3 = input

Let's write a program wich XOR the flag with 3:

#include <stdio.h>
#include <stdlib.h>
#include <strings.h>
#include <string.h>

void main(){
    char v7[104] = "[.NBPx67m47\\26\\a7g\\74\\o2`0m60\\`k0`h2m5~" ;
    int i;
    char s1;

    for (i = 0; v7[i]; ++i){
        s1 = v7[i]^3;
        printf("%c", s1);
    }
    return;
}

FLAG

X-MAS{54n74_15_b4d_47_l1c3n53_ch3ck1n6}
